A storage tank consists of a circular cylinder with a hemisphere adjoined on either end. If the external diameter of the cylinder be 1.4 m and its length be 8 m, find the cost of painting it on the outside at the rate of Rs. 10 per m2.

The figure is given below:



Concept Used:


The curved surface area of a cylinder = 2πrh


The curved surface area of hemisphere = 2πr2


Given: External Diameter of the cylinder = 1.4 m


Length of the cylinder = 8 m


Cost of painting on the outside = Rs. 10 per m2


Explanation:



Thus r = 0.7m and h = 8m


Total curved surface area of the tank = 2πrh + 2πr2


Total curved surface area


Therefore, the total surface area of the storage tank is 38.28 m2.


Cost of painting it on the outside at the rate of Rs. 10 per m2 =


38.28 × 10 = Rs. 382.80


Hence, the cost of painting the storage tank from the inside is Rs. 382.80.
